EGR 376
Electric Vehicles and Mobility: Components and Systems
Arizona State University Digital Immersion ·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Focuses on understanding the functionality and design optimization of electric powertrain of electric vehicles (EVs). The major components inside an EV include electric motor, power inverter, drive circuit, battery, battery management system, sensors and encoders. Discusses component-level understanding and system-level design details of the foundational electrical elements of an EV. Students learn the use of MATLAB/Simulink to conduct system-level modeling and analysis. Incorporates design projects involving design and simulation of powertrain components subjected to specific design and performance requirements.
